MTNL Brings Unlimited GPRS at Rs.14

To attract youngsters to encash their interest in social networking sites like Face Book Orkut etc, Mumbai’s leading GSM mobile service provider Mahanagar Telephone Nigam Ltd today announced the launch of 2 Unlimited GPRS- Mobile Internet Recharge at Rs.14 and Rs.98 for its 2G GSM Trump Prepaid mobile subscribers in Mumbai telecom circle.

If GPRS connection cost is burning a hole in your pocket than one can heave a sigh of relief as MTNL Mumbai has launched cheapest unlimited GPRS plan for Rs.14 for 3 Days and Rs.98 per month for Trump prepaid customers.

Details of MTNL Trump Unlimited GPRS Data Recharge-:

1. Trump 2G Unlimited GPRS Card Rs.14-:Unlimited GPRS browsing and Downloads valid for 3 Days.

2. Trump 2G Unlimited GPRS Card Rs.98-: Unlimited Mobile GPRS browsing and Downloads valid for 30 Days and free talk time of Rs.27.

These GPRS Recharge card applicable for 2G prepaid customers and subscribe can access Mobile GPRS or Pocket Internet as well as PC or Laptop connectivity with their Trump mobile.

Terms and Conditions-:

  • This coupon is valid for 2G having GPRS facility customers only.
  • After recharging this coupon customer has to wait for the confirmation message “unlimited browsing plan activated” before availing Unlimited data browsing.
  • If a customer opt 3G mobile service or sends ACT 3G in between then the benefits of this coupon will be lost.
  • If any 3G Jadoo customer Recharges with this coupons, they will get only 3 Mb (Rs.14/- coupon) and 20 Mb (Rs.98 coupon)
